## Deployment

Tabulate, our report builder, ships with stable sorting enabled by default as of this cycle — a point worth flagging at the weekly sync, since several downstream teams depended on the old unstable tie-breaking and saw row-order diffs in snapshot tests. Deployment is a standard blue-green rollout; the sort engine flag is read at startup only, so toggling it requires a restart, not a hot reload. Snapshot baselines should be regenerated after the first deploy. The deployed configuration values are as follows.

settings of fafog-haduf:
ZORIX_PIN=4648
ZORIX_METRICS_HOST=metrics.zorix.paliqsys.corp
ZORIX_LOG_LEVEL=info
ZORIX_TENANT=druix

TURN-208: Gatevale turnstile counters at the Merrow Field pilot double-count when a rotation reverses mid-cycle. Attendance totals drift roughly 2% high per event. The debounce window fix is implemented, reviewed by Ilsa, and soak-tested across two simulated match days without drift. Ready for your cut; the candidate build is identified below.

trace token, tagag-tafog: htk6_5ed18c

Subject: Thumbnail queue ownership change

Team,

Effective Monday, ownership of the Snapgrain thumbnail generation queue moves off the platform group. Escalation path changes: stuck jobs, oversized-source failures, and retry storms go to the new owner, not the old rotation. Runbook location is unchanged. SLA stays at four hours for queue incidents. Do not reassign old tickets; only route new ones the new way. Questions about the transition itself can wait until Monday's handover call. New responsible owner is listed below.

signatory, yagap-bawig: Ulaath Eliath

Subject: Lease renegotiation — Bramleigh site

Team: talks with the Bramleigh landlord concluded yesterday. Headline terms: seven-year extension, 9% rent reduction, fit-out contribution secured for the ground floor showroom. Break clause at year four retained. Sales leads should plan on the site staying operational through the transition — no disruption to the Copperfield launch. Legal review wraps Friday; signature expected next week. One confidential note on related plans is appended directly below this message.

confidential, kagep-kahof: Druokax Systems plans to lower the Ulaath list price by 53 percent in March.